    I just played a challenge for 150 credits and it said the winner wins 135 credits.  How come WGT only gave me 120 credits and kept 30?

  • alosso
    21,094 Posts
    Fri, Nov 22 2013 7:07 AM

    150 crs challenge, 10% = 15 crs rake from each, the wager is 135 crs.

    You win, get 135 crs from your opponent, WGT gets the your part of the rake from you. Net win 120 crs.

    Look into your account - it's there.

    No. You're not paying WGT twice. Alosso is mainly referring to the total purse you win because WGT deducted 10% from each player's contribution to the purse, not just the loser.

    Say you and your opponent both have 1,000 credits total and you enter a 150 challenge.

    You now have 850,:your opponent has 850.

    You've combined 300 into the prize purse.

    WGT takes 10% (30) of the total amount wagered (300) making the total prize purse 270.

    You win the challenge.

    Your opponent remains at 850 total credits.

    You win the 270 credit purse, when added to your 850 gives you 1120, or a net gain of 120 to the 1,000 you had before you ever entered the match...

     

    A lot of people forget to account for the amount deducted from their own bet into the game.

    See "Matchplay Challenge" in the FAQ:

    WGT will withhold 10% of the challenge amount from each player as a fee for running the game. For example if each player challenges 100 credits, WGT will withhold 10 credits from each player as the fee. Therefore the winner of the match will win 90 credits from their opponent.
